What is the Cincinnati Open?
Before we dive into the specifics of the 2025 edition, let's take a quick look at what makes the Cincinnati Open so special. The Western & Southern Open is one of the oldest tennis tournaments in the United States, with a rich history dating back to 1899. It's a combined men's and women's event, meaning you get to see the top ATP and WTA players battling it out on the same courts. Held annually at the Lindner Family Tennis Center in Mason, Ohio, the tournament is a Masters 1000 event on the ATP Tour and a WTA 1000 event on the WTA Tour. This puts it in the top tier of tournaments outside of the Grand Slams, attracting the biggest names in tennis. When is the Cincinnati Open 2025?
Alright, let's get to the important stuff – when exactly is the Cincinnati Open 2025? While the official dates can vary slightly from year to year, the tournament typically takes place in mid-August. For 2025, you can expect the Cincinnati Open to be held around the same timeframe, usually the second week of August. Keep an eye on the official Western & Southern Open website for the exact dates, which are usually announced several months in advance. Ticket Options
The Cincinnati Open offers a variety of ticket options to suit different preferences and budgets. Here are a few popular choices:
- Single-Session Tickets: These tickets get you access to a specific session, whether it's a day or evening of matches. Perfect if you want to catch a particular player or round.
- Multi-Session Packages: If you're planning to attend multiple days, these packages offer a cost-effective way to enjoy the tournament. They often cover specific rounds or days.
- Weekly Packages: For the ultimate tennis experience, a weekly package gives you access to all sessions throughout the tournament. You'll be immersed in the action from start to finish!
- Suites and Premium Seating: Looking for a VIP experience? Suites and premium seating options offer the best views, along with amenities like catering and lounge access. It's a fantastic way to enjoy the tournament in style.

Accommodation Options
- Hotels in Mason: Mason is the closest city to the Lindner Family Tennis Center, offering a variety of hotels ranging from budget-friendly to upscale. Staying in Mason puts you within easy reach of the tournament venue.
- Hotels in Cincinnati: If you prefer to stay in a larger city, Cincinnati is about a 30-minute drive from the tennis center. Cincinnati offers a wider range of accommodation options, as well as attractions and dining experiences.
